1. Fan Token Sector Weakness
The decline appears part of a broader downturn in the fan token niche. Data from OKX spot markets showed other fan tokens, including Trabzonspor Fan Token (TRA) and Portugal National Team Fan Token (POR), among the top losers in recent 15-minute intervals. This suggests capital rotating away from the speculative sports token sector rather than a SPURS-specific issue.
What it means: The token's price is highly sensitive to sentiment shifts within its small, niche market segment.
Watch for: Continued price action of major peers like $CHZ and other club tokens for sector direction.
2. No Clear Secondary Driver
No specific news, partnerships, or on-chain catalysts for Tottenham Hotspur Fan Token were found in the provided data. The token's 24-hour trading volume also fell 10.47%, indicating a lack of new buying interest to counter the sell-off.
What it means: The move lacks a single, identifiable secondary catalyst and is best explained by the sector-wide flow.
